The TLV5614IDR is a precision digital-to-analog converter (DAC) from Texas Instruments, designed to deliver high-performance and accuracy in a compact form factor. This 12-bit DAC features a quad-channel output, making it suitable for a wide range of applications, including industrial control systems, automated test equipment, and digital signal processing.
Key Features
- Resolution: 12-bit quad-channel DAC, ensuring precise analog output for multiple signals.
- Interface: Features a versatile 3-wire serial interface that is compatible with SPI, QSPI™, MICROWIRE™, and DSP interface standards, providing easy integration with a variety of microcontrollers and digital systems.
- Settling Time: Fast settling time of 4.5 µs to within ±0.5 LSB, which allows for quick updates and responsive system performance.
- Low Power Consumption: Operates with a low power supply range from 2.7V to 5.5V, making it ideal for battery-powered and portable applications.
- Output Range: Programmable output range with a reference voltage that allows for a flexible output of 0V to Vref or 0V to 2 x Vref.
- Package: Available in a small 14-pin SOIC package, minimizing board space and simplifying PCB design.
- Temperature Range: Industrial temperature range of -40°C to 85°C, ensuring reliable performance across various environmental conditions.
